Laudes-Marie Neigedaout, an albino foundling abandoned by her unknown mother one August night on the eve of the Second World War, spends her first few years with a community of nuns. But her presence among them is not wholly welcome, and in 1944 the little girl is dispatched into the outside world. This marks the start of what proves to be a lifelong odyssey that brings her into contact over the years with an extraordinary array of fascinating characters. She becomes the compassionate chronicler and plumbs the mysterious depths of the human heart. France's greatest living novelist covers fifty years of rural and Parisian life, from World War II to the present day. She follows the life of an albino child abandoned at birth at a convent and her subsequent life as a servant, a domestic in a brothel, and as an abandoned street-walker.
